卖逼视频免费看片|狼人就干网中文字慕|成人av影院导航|人妻少妇精品无码专区二区妖婧|亚洲丝袜视频玖玖|一区二区免费中文|日本高清无码一区|国产91无码小说|国产黄片子视频91sese日韩|免费高清无码成人网站入口

pycharm退出是直接保存嗎 如何自學(xué)matlab編程或者python編程?

如何自學(xué)matlab編程或者python編程?在matlab中,數(shù)組基本上是用來存儲數(shù)據(jù)的,數(shù)組中的單個數(shù)據(jù)可以通過在數(shù)組名后面放一個括號來訪問,這個就在括號里。對應(yīng)于數(shù)據(jù)的行和列標(biāo)簽。如果數(shù)組是行向

如何自學(xué)matlab編程或者python編程?

在matlab中,數(shù)組基本上是用來存儲數(shù)據(jù)的,數(shù)組中的單個數(shù)據(jù)可以通過在數(shù)組名后面放一個括號來訪問,這個就在括號里。

對應(yīng)于數(shù)據(jù)的行和列標(biāo)簽。如果數(shù)組是行向量或列向量,只需要一個下標(biāo)。這與C語言中的數(shù)組不同,C語言中的行和列的下標(biāo)都是從1開始的。

A[1 2 3 4],那么A(2)表示數(shù)據(jù)2而不是3。

命名規(guī)則:matlab的變量名必須以字母開頭,后面是字母、數(shù)字和下劃線(_)。

良好的編程習(xí)慣:

1.給你的變量取一個描述性的、容易記憶的變量名。例如,貨幣匯率可以命名為exchange_rate。這種方讓你的程序更加清晰易懂。

2.為每個程序創(chuàng)建一個數(shù)據(jù)字典,以增強程序的可維護性。數(shù)據(jù)字典列出了您在該程序中使用的所有變量的定義。其定義應(yīng)包括本項要描述的內(nèi)容和執(zhí)行的單位。

3.每次使用變量時,我們都應(yīng)該確保變量名的大小寫準(zhǔn)確匹配。在變量名中只使用小寫字母是一個好的編程習(xí)慣。

在像C這樣的語言中,變量類型和變量必須在使用之前聲明。我們稱這種語言為強類型語言。相比之下,像MATLAB這樣的語言被稱為弱類型語言。變量可以通過簡單的賦值來創(chuàng)建,變量的類型取決于創(chuàng)建時的類型。

特殊變量:

Inf這個符號代表無窮大,通常是除以0產(chǎn)生的。

符號NaN表示沒有這個數(shù),它通常是通過數(shù)算得到的。比如0除以0。

Clock是一個特殊的變量,包含當(dāng)前的年、月、日、時、分、秒,是一個6元素的線向量。

以字符形式表示的當(dāng)前日期,例如30-Dec-2013。

如何爬取百度圖片的內(nèi)容?

這與緩存無關(guān)。百度圖片的信息是動態(tài)加載的。在一個json文件中,需要抓取包并進行分析,提取圖片的url進行下載。這里我簡單介紹一下如何抓取百度圖片的網(wǎng)址信息并下載。實驗環(huán)境win7 python3.6 pycharm是兩個函數(shù),很簡單。讓 首先發(fā)布源代碼,如下所示:

導(dǎo)入請求

導(dǎo)入json

導(dǎo)入時間

d:

獲取圖片url信息

Image_urls[] #存儲圖片url信息。

_ comampinrjampword風(fēng)京圖片大全amppn60amprn30

(urlurl) #請求json文件

Response.encodingutf-8 #設(shè)置編碼。

Datajson.loads (r: #獲得圖片下載的網(wǎng)址信息的項目。

if (replaceUrl)和len((replac:

Image _ (replac:

下載圖片

Imag:

try:

#成功下載

(imag: pictur:除外

#下載失敗

Print(: % s %(I 1,imag:

主要功能

downloadImage()

以下是主要步驟:

1.獲取包分析頁面。按F12調(diào)出開發(fā)者工具,刷新頁面,依次點擊網(wǎng)絡(luò)、XHR、預(yù)覽,可以看到動態(tài)加載的圖片信息。在這里,我把百度圖片 "風(fēng)景圖片全集 "舉個例子,而且網(wǎng)址是_Ramppvampic0ampnc1ampzam。PSE 1 ampshowtab 0 ampfb 0 amp width ampweight amp face 0 amp stype 2 amp euf-8 amp hs 2 amp word風(fēng)景圖片大全ampf3ampoq風(fēng)景圖片大全amprsp0,如下:

我們可以在developer s工具。以下是json中的圖片信息,我們需要提取這些數(shù)據(jù):

對應(yīng)json文件的url信息可以直接在表頭查看,如下圖所示:

2.現(xiàn)在我們可以解析json文件了。請注意,并不是url中的所有參數(shù)都有用。這里只提出TNResultJSON _ COMAMPINRJAMMPWORD風(fēng)景圖片百科amppn60amprn30的參數(shù)。核心是提取第二個ObjURL信息,這是圖片所在的位置。主要代碼如下:

3.成功提取圖像信息后,我們就可以下載圖像了。這里比較簡單,主要用的是包請求,也就是基本的文件寫操作,二進制寫就可以了。主要代碼如下:

程序運行如下,下載信息已經(jīng)打印出來:

相應(yīng)的圖片也在f: pictureaidu目錄下下載了:

這里的一些圖片可以 下載后無法顯示,因為url無效。

至此,我們已經(jīng)完成了百度圖片信息的提取和圖片的下載??v觀整個過程,it s其實很簡單,就是抓取包分析,得到j(luò)son文件,然后解析,提取你需要的信息,最后下載圖片。只要有一定的python基礎(chǔ),知道基本的python爬蟲,就可以快速抓取并下載圖片信息。網(wǎng)上也有很多這方面的信息。你可以去搜一下,對你會有很大的幫助。我贏了。;這里就不贅述了。希望上面分享的內(nèi)容能夠正確。

標(biāo)簽: